Marathon Oil Co. (NYSE:MRO) Stock Position Increased by Victory Capital Management Inc.

Victory Capital Management Inc. increased its position in Marathon Oil Co. (NYSE:MRO - Free Report) by 127.3% during the 4th quarter, according to its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The firm owned 2,527,604 shares of the oil and gas producer's stock after acquiring an additional 1,415,639 shares during the quarter. Victory Capital Management Inc. owned about 0.43% of Marathon Oil worth $61,067,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Marathon Oil Stock Performance

NYSE MRO traded up $0.25 during trading on Friday, reaching $26.34. 9,055,754 shares of the company's stock were exchanged, compared to its average volume of 9,206,166. Marathon Oil Co. has a fifty-two week low of $21.63 and a fifty-two week high of $30.06. The stock has a market capitalization of $15.05 billion, a P/E ratio of 10.88 and a beta of 2.22. The business has a 50 day moving average price of $27.03 and a 200-day moving average price of $25.38.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.30, a current ratio of 0.40 and a quick ratio of 0.35.

Marathon Oil (NYSE:MRO -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, May 1st. The oil and gas producer reported $0.55 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.52 by $0.03. Marathon Oil had a net margin of 21.83% and a return on equity of 13.22%. The firm had revenue of $1.55 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$1.56 billion. During the same period in the prior year, the firm earned $0.67 EPS. The business's revenue was down 7.7% on a year-over-year basis. Sell-side analysts forecast that Marathon Oil Co. will post 2.83 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Marathon Oil Dividend Announcement

The company also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Monday, June 10th. Investors of record on Wednesday, May 15th will be given a dividend of $0.11 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Tuesday, May 14th. This represents a $0.44 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 1.67%. Marathon Oil's dividend payout ratio is 18.18%.

Marathon Oil Profile

(Free Report)

Marathon Oil Corporation, an independent exploration and production company, engages in exploration, production, and marketing of crude oil and condensate, natural gas liquids, and natural gas in the United States and internationally. The company also produces and markets products manufactured from natural gas, such as liquefied natural gas and methanol.
